本文提出同时测定季铵盐苄基氯化铵中氯化苄、苯甲醇的新方法。采用高效液相色谱法,以C18(4.6mm×250mm,5μm)为分离柱;磷酸二氢盐—甲醇进行梯度洗脱;检测波长为210nm;柱温为25℃;流速为1.0m L/min。结果表明氯化苄在6.5~130μg/m L(r=0.9998),苯甲醇在6.25~125μg/m L(r=0.9999)浓度范围内呈良好的线性关系,氯化苄和苯甲醇的回收率分别为95.00~102.00%和102.86~105.71%,检出限分别为3.0μg/g、1.5μg/g。该方法操作简单,未用到有毒的试剂,准确性高,是季铵盐原料质量控制的理想方法。
This paper presents a new method for the simultaneous determination of benzyl chloride and benzyl alcohol in the quaternary ammonium salt of benzyl ammonium chloride. High performance liquid chromatography with C18 (4.6mm × 250mm, 5μm) as the separation column; dihydrogen phosphate - methanol gradient elution; detection wavelength of 210nm; column temperature of 25 ℃; flow rate of 1.0m L / min . The results showed that there was a good linear relationship between the concentration of benzyl chloride in the range of 6.5 ~ 130μg / mL (r = 0.9998) and benzyl alcohol in the range of 6.25 ~ 125μg / mL (r = 0.9999). The recovery of benzyl chloride and benzyl alcohol Respectively 95.00 ~ 102.00% and 102.86 ~ 105.71%, the detection limits were 3.0μg / g and 1.5μg / g, respectively. The method is simple to operate, does not use toxic reagents and has high accuracy, and is an ideal method for quality control of quaternary ammonium raw materials.
